    When doing an inventory, do I have to enter books in call number order? I've inherited a library that hasn't done an inventory in years and the collection has drastically changed since then. Any help insight would be appreciated!

    1. Hello! Please take a look at our Inventory guides. You do NOT have to enter the books in call number order, although you can, and you can turn on an alert so it lets you know when you've entered them out of order (smile)
